The Effect of High-Altitude on Human Skeletal Muscle Energetics: (31)P-MRS Results from the Caudwell Xtreme Everest Expedition
Many disease states are associated with regional or systemic hypoxia. The study of healthy individuals exposed to high-altitude hypoxia offers a way to explore hypoxic adaptation without the confounding effects of disease and therapeutic interventions.
